Top Most Expensive Picks: IPL Auction 2023

Australian pacer Mitchell Starc became the talking point of the IPL auction 2023, as Kolkata Knight Riders (KKR) broke the bank with a staggering ₹24.75 crores to secure his services, making him the most expensive player in the history of IPL. Starc, returning to the IPL after a hiatus, outstripped the record previously held by his compatriot, Pat Cummins, who was sold to Sunrisers Hyderabad (SRH) for an already impressive ₹20.50 crores.

The auctions also saw a notable investment in uncapped talent, pointing to the franchises’ faith in burgeoning potential. Sameer Rizwi, a name that resonated throughout the auction hall, was picked by Chennai Super Kings (CSK) for ₹8.4 crores, alongside Shubham Dubey, who found his stride with Rajasthan Royals (RR) for ₹5.8 crores.

Chennai Super Kings fortified their ranks by laying out ₹14 crores for Kiwi batting all-rounder Daryl Mitchell. Meanwhile, Punjab Kings (PBKS) placed a hefty bet of ₹11.75 crores on Indian pacer Harshal Patel. Another high-profile transaction saw Mumbai Indians (MI) embrace South African pacer Gerald Coetzee for ₹5 crores.

Teams Final Tally: The Strategic Choices

 

In IPL auction 2023, Kolkata Knight Riders (KKR) invested heavily in established names, earmarking the future of their bowling attack by acquiring Mitchell Starc, and also added Mujeeb Ur Rahman to their spin arsenal.

Sunrisers Hyderabad (SRH) reinforced their pace battery by bagging Pat Cummins and the World Cup hero Travis Head, indicating a clear focus on fast bowling assets.

Chennai Super Kings (CSK) leaned on promising local talent and international experience, signifying a blend of youth and strategic nous.

Rajasthan Royals (RR), always on the lookout for evolving talent, made some decisive moves by roping in players like Shubham Dubey and Nandre Burger.

Punjab Kings (PBKS) focused on reinforcing their bowling lineup with the likes of Harshal Patel, showcasing their intent to build a formidable bowling crew.

Mumbai Indians (MI), known for their keen scouting acumen, grabbed prospects like Gerald Coetzee, along with seasoned T20 travelers such as Nabi.

Royal Challengers Bangalore (RCB) managed to snap up promising and proven talents like Alzarri Joseph and Lockie Ferguson, to beef up their pace department.
